Treebank Statistics: UD_Gorontalo-BungoLoLombi: POS Tags: PRON

There are 4 PRON lemmas (5%), 4 PRON types (4%) and 8 PRON tokens (4%). Out of 11 observed tags, the rank of PRON is: 7 in number of lemmas, 7 in number of types and 8 in number of tokens.

The 10 most frequent PRON lemmas: wau, tiyo, ami, liyo

The 10 most frequent PRON types: wau, Tiyo, Ami, liyo

Morphology

The form / lemma ratio of PRON is 1.000000 (the average of all parts of speech is 1.172840).

The 1st highest number of forms (1) was observed with the lemma “ami”: Ami.

The 2nd highest number of forms (1) was observed with the lemma “liyo”: liyo.

The 3rd highest number of forms (1) was observed with the lemma “tiyo”: Tiyo.

PRON occurs with 4 features: Number (8; 100% instances), PronType (8; 100% instances), Person (7; 88% instances), Case (3; 38% instances)

PRON occurs with 7 feature-value pairs: Case=Gen, Case=Nom, Number=Plur, Number=Sing, Person=1, Person=3, PronType=Prs

PRON occurs with 5 feature combinations. The most frequent feature combination is Number=Sing|Person=1|PronType=Prs (4 tokens). Examples: wau

Relations

PRON nodes are attached to their parents using 3 different relations: nsubj:agent (5; 63% instances), nsubj (2; 25% instances), nmod:poss (1; 13% instances)

Parents of PRON nodes belong to 3 different parts of speech: VERB (5; 63% instances), NOUN (2; 25% instances), ADV (1; 13% instances)

8 (100%) PRON nodes are leaves.

The highest child degree of a PRON node is 0.
